Inova Health System, University of Virginia fund first joint research projects with seed fund

Inova Health System and University of Virginia are kicking off their new partnership with $450,000 in seed money to fund nine joint research projects geared toward better predicting, preventing and treating disease. Brandeis University Named National Science Foundation I-Corps Site to Fund Campus Discoveries

Brandeis University today announced it has been awarded a $237,050 five-year grant from the National Science Foundation (NSF) Innovation Corps (I-CorpsTM) program. The grant will provide funding for innovative startups and technologies developed by Brandeis students, faculty and staff. Brandeis is one of only six new sites nationally designated by NSF. University of Malta puts up €100,000 in seed funding to help start-ups take off

Entrepreneurs, start-ups and researchers can tap €100,000 in seed funding offered by a University of Malta award. The Take Off seed fund award (TOSFA), now in its fourth year, seeks to aid entrepreneurs, start-ups and researchers mould their ideas and technologies into investor-ready and market-ready businesses.
